About Chitrakadi Vati
Chitrakadi Vati is a fourteen-ingredient classical tablet built around Chitrak, along with a group of classical salts (Saindhav, Sanchal, Romak, Samudra, Bid Lavan) and digestive spices, described in Bharat Bhaishajya Ratnakar (1743) as Agnipradipak (digestive-fire-kindling).
It is traditionally used for Kupachan (poor digestion), Amadosha (classical toxin build-up from incomplete digestion), and low appetite, as part of an individually directed formulation.
Composition (per the pack’s own declared proportions)
| Ingredient | Botanical / Common name | Quantity |
|---|---|---|
| Chitrak | Plumbago zeylanica | 17.857 mg |
| Pippali mool | Piper longum (long pepper root) | 17.857 mg |
| Sajjikhaar | alkali salt preparation | 17.857 mg |
| Saindhav | rock salt | 17.857 mg |
| Sanchal namak | black salt variety | 17.857 mg |
| Romak lavan | classical salt variety | 17.857 mg |
| Samudra lavan | sea salt | 17.857 mg |
| Bid lavan | black salt | 17.857 mg |
| Sunthi | Zingiber officinale (dry ginger) | 17.857 mg |
| Marich | Piper nigrum (black pepper) | 17.857 mg |
| Pippali | Piper longum (long pepper) | 17.857 mg |
| Ajmoda | Trachyspermum roxburghianum | 17.857 mg |
| Shudhdha Hing | purified Ferula asafoetida | 17.857 mg |
| Chavak | Piper chaba | 17.857 mg |
Mfg: Virgo UAP Pharma. Fourteen ingredients per Bharat Bhaishajya Ratnakar (1743), processed with a Bijora Nimbu Swarasa Bhavana (levigation), quantity as required.
How to Use
2 Tablets twice a day with warm water, or as directed by a qualified Ayurvedic physician.

Why does this tablet contain several kinds of salt?
Classical formulations of this type traditionally use a Panchalavan or similar salt group alongside digestive spices — this is the standard classical composition, reproduced exactly as printed on the pack.
